I combined two stamp sets for this card — Seriously the Best for the sentiment and Little Ladybug for the images.

I stamped the flower on some white card stock and cut it out with a stitched shapes circle.  The ladybug was stamped on another piece and cut out with my paper snips.  I colored them with markers and adhered them to a piece of dsp from the Pleased as Punch dsp package.

The sentiment was stamped on a piece of black card stock and embossed with white embossing powder.

I wanted to make a card to send to my daughter at college, and I thought the Little Ladybug stamp set, which is a Sale-a-Bration hostess set, which is free with any order of $300 or more, would be perfect for a card for her.

This is another Sale-a-Bration set that will have coordinating dies for purchase starting February 4.  I used them to cut out the two ladybugs and the flower.  I sponged some ink on a piece of card stock to create the background for the scene.
